Complete Buyer's Guide: How to Choose Baby Shampoo for Curly Hair

1. 1. Prioritize Moisture & Hydration

Curly hair is naturally drier because oils from the scalp have a harder time traveling down the spiral shape of the strand. Avoid shampoos with sulfates (SLS/SLES), as these harsh cleansers strip away essential moisture. Instead, look for hydrating ingredients like shea butter, coconut oil, avocado oil, or oat extract. These will cleanse gently while depositing moisture, leaving curls soft and less prone to frizz.

2. 2. Seek Out Detangling "Slip"

Brushing dry curls is a recipe for breakage and tears. The best time to detangle is during or after washing when hair is lubricated. Look for shampoos and conditioners that mention “detangling,” “smoothing,” or “slip.” Ingredients like evening primrose oil (in our Babo Botanicals pick) or creamy formulas provide that slippery texture that allows combs to glide through knots effortlessly, making the whole process less stressful for your child.

3. 3. Understand "Tear-Free" Formulas

“Tear-free” doesn’t mean “won’t sting if poured directly in the eye.” It means the formula is pH-balanced to match tears, so it won’t irritate if a small amount gets near the eyes. This is non-negotiable for wiggly babies. All our top picks are tear-free. For maximum gentleness, consider fragrance-free options if your baby has sensitive skin or eczema, as perfumes can sometimes be irritants.

4. 4. Decide Between 2-in-1s and Separate Systems

2-in-1 Shampoo & Conditioners (like SheaMoisture or Babo Botanicals) are fantastic for simplicity and for babies with fine or loose curls. They’re quick and minimize product overload. Separate Shampoo and Conditioner sets (like Aveeno or Dove) often provide deeper, more targeted conditioning, which is better for thick, dense, or very dry curls. For advanced styling, a dedicated leave-in conditioner or curl cream (found in the SheaMoisture or Maya Mari sets) can add definition and hold.

5. 5. Check for Hypoallergenic & Clean Certifications

Baby skin is incredibly absorbent. Look for terms like “hypoallergenic,” “dermatologist-tested,” “pediatrician-approved,” or certifications like EWG Verified. These indicate the formula has been vetted for gentleness. Also, scan ingredient lists to avoid common irritants if your child has known sensitivities-popular free-from claims include paraben-free, phthalate-free, and gluten-free.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I use regular adult shampoo on my baby's curly hair?

It’s not recommended. Adult shampoos are often formulated with stronger cleansers (sulfates) and different pH levels that can be too harsh for a baby’s delicate scalp and developing hair follicles. They can strip the natural oils curly hair desperately needs, leading to dryness, irritation, and more frizz. Baby and kid-specific shampoos are gentler, tear-free, and designed for that sensitive skin.

2. How often should I wash my baby's curly hair?

This depends on your baby’s age and activity level. For newborns and infants, 2-3 times a week is usually plenty. Over-washing can dry out their scalp. For active toddlers, you might wash 2-3 times a week, using just water or a conditioner-co-wash on other days if needed. The key is to watch for signs of dryness (flakiness, itchiness) or oiliness. Curly hair generally thrives with less frequent washing to retain its natural moisture.

3. My baby's curls are always frizzy after washing. What am I doing wrong?

Frizz is usually a sign of moisture loss. First, ensure you’re using a moisturizing shampoo without sulfates. Second, don’t rub hair dry with a towel-this roughs up the cuticle and creates frizz. Instead, gently squeeze out excess water with a soft cotton t-shirt or microfiber towel. Finally, consider using a tiny amount of a kid-safe leave-in conditioner or cream on wet hair to seal in moisture and define the curl pattern, which helps fight frizz.

4. Is it necessary to use a separate conditioner for baby curls?

Not always, but it’s often very helpful. A good 2-in-1 can work well for fine or loosely curled hair. However, for thicker, coarser, or very tangled curls, a separate conditioner provides more concentrated moisture and slip, making detangling much easier and providing longer-lasting hydration. It’s worth trying a dedicated conditioner if you’re struggling with manageability after using a 2-in-1.
